Second highest scoring team in the league, but also one of the worst at preventing them. Third in batting average, tied for 2nd in slugging. Rucinski will be tough to beat in the playoffs.
The Outlook
What a fun series! Two rivals, tied 4-4 during the season, battling to move on. If the season is any indication, many runs will be scored, while not much leather will be flashed. ATVL can't help but think, however, that the road to the finals still goes through Luray. New Market has been struggling too much lately... Wranglers in two.
